Transaction ab7f62b5dccbbaf5842095618b02319212eb017cc141704808f2f98b80286261
1 Input
1 Output
-
ab7f62b5dccbbaf5842095618b02319212eb017cc141704808f2f98b80286261:0
- value
- 4792369
- script pubkey
- OP_0 OP_PUSHBYTES_20 597b3f5f6f66783880036543bc4f65d6792cc7dc
- address
- bc1qt9an7hm0veur3qqrv4pmcnm96euje37u56ajrs